It can even be argued that none of Op Artwork would have been attainable—not to mention embraced by the general public—with no prior Abstract and Expressionist actions. These led the best way by de-emphasizing (or, in many scenarios, eliminating) representational material.

4 Self-Distorting Grids exemplifies the influence of Kinetic artwork on opart Op. Movement was very important to Op art, and while Op artists normally relied on virtual motion - the illusion of movement - some artists used authentic motion to build results. During this piece, Morellet experimented with grid kinds. He was keen on the way in which their pre-specified character, their frequent-perception physical appearance, authorized him to escape regular approaches to composition through which one Section of a design is balanced from An additional portion.

Right here Cruz-Diez examined Bauhaus teacher Joannes Itten's idea on the simultaneous perception of different hues as a result of parallel line placement, linear shock, plus the fusion of tonalities. The totality of results results in the illusion of a moving graphic, exemplifying traits of Op art and Kinetic artwork.
